Hancock Aviation LLC is Hiring a Manager of Aircraft Services Near Baton Rouge, LA

About Hancock Aviation:
Hancock Aviation has been a leader in aviation services for over 10 years, providing top-tier maintenance, repair, and overhaul services to a diverse clientele. We pride ourselves on safety, quality, and delivering exceptional customer experiences.

Position Overview:
Hancock Aviation is seeking a dedicated and experienced Manager of Aircraft Services to join our team. This role is crucial for overseeing our aircraft maintenance and services department, ensuring operational efficiency, high-quality service delivery, and compliance with all regulatory requirements.

Responsibilities:

  • Lead the aircraft services department, including maintenance, repairs, and installations.
  • Manage day-to-day operations ensuring efficient use of resources and meeting of project timelines.
  • Oversee a team of technicians and support staff, providing leadership, training, and development opportunities.
  • Maintain strong relationships with clients, ensuring high levels of satisfaction and repeat business.
  • Implement and oversee quality assurance measures to meet or exceed FAA standards.
  • Manage budgets, forecast resources, and schedule necessary for departmental success.
  • Develop and implement strategies for service improvement, cost reduction, and increased profitability.
  • Conduct performance reviews, manage work order processes, and ensure compliance with safety regulations.
  • Stay updated on industry trends, technologies, and best practices to drive innovation within the department.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Aviation Management, Aerospace Engineering, or a related field.
  • A&P certification and/or additional technical training in aviation maintenance.
  • Minimum of 10 years' experience in aviation maintenance, with at least 5 years in a managerial role.
  • Proven experience in managing full-scale aircraft maintenance operations.
  • Strong leadership skills with a track record of developing effective teams.
  • Excellent communication, organizational, and decision-making skills.
  • Familiarity with various aircraft models, including knowledge of maintenance requirements and service upgrades.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ously with a focus on resolving operational challenges.
